Breakfast: Two bowls of oatmeal with Justin’s Maple Almond Butter (obsessed) and Barney Butter + strawberries + a handful of almonds + a bowl of watermelon (I was too happy to eat it to take a picture)

When food looks & tastes good

Lunch: Sushi bowl. Quinoa salad with dried cranberries (the quinoa was cooked with half almond milk and half water…so good), zucchini noodles, sushi grade tuna with ginger, 1/2 avocado.

When food looks & tastes good

Un-pictured snack: carrots + almonds + kombucha

Dinner: Fresh Kitchen, one of my favorite spots in Tampa because everything is gluten-free.
In my bowl: sweet potato noodles, kale slaw, citrus chicken, grilled steak, honey roasted carrots and coconut cauliflower. My mom and I ate dinner outside. It was perfect.

When food looks & tastes good

Snack: Apple (with a side of dog) and peanut butter
